Transaction 080ecfb8110a96ff5a02546a757bdb176a3e9f39f39c754f168a3e60fd62b095
1 Input
1 Output
-
080ecfb8110a96ff5a02546a757bdb176a3e9f39f39c754f168a3e60fd62b095:0
- value
- 57401295
- script pubkey
- OP_0 OP_PUSHBYTES_20 9503c690af8b5d192dcb3872b8a4f305d9ecdf52
- address
- bc1qj5pudy903dw3jtwt8pet3f8nqhv7eh6j8fslfq